Largo Farm community shared agriculture celebrating 20th anniversary

Largo Farm community shared agriculture celebrating 20th anniversary

Twenty years ago, Judy Ternier and Tom Burns began what’s known as a CSA. This acronym stands for community shared agriculture. In this system, customers buy a share in the garden before the growing season begins.
